Ingredients
for
4
- Ingredients
- 8 slices whole grain bread
- 80 grams cream cheese
- 2 Tomatoes
- 4 sheets Lettuce
- 2 Beet sprouts (or radish sprouts)
- 4 slices Emmentaler cheese (or young Gouda)
- salt
- freshly ground peppers

Preparation steps
1.
Spread 1 teaspoon of cream cheese on each slice of bread. Rinse tomatoes. Rinse lettuce, trim and spin dry. Rinse beet sprouts with cold water and drain.
2.
Remove stems on tomatoes and cut crosswise into slices. Tear lettuce into bite-sized pieces.
3.
Arrange four slices of bread on a work surface, cover with Emmentaler cheese and tomatoes and season with salt and pepper. Place sprouts and lettuce on tomatoes and cover with another slice of bread.
4.
Cut bread diagonally and secure each with a toothpick. Serve immediately.
